THEODOSIUS II AV SOLIDUS, 423/424 C.E.
RIC 312, MIB 33a, Good Extremely Fine, 21.3mm, 4.48 grams, Constantinople mint, 5th Officina
Obverse: DN THEODOSIVS P F AVG, around helmeted, pearl-diademed & cuirassed three-quarter facing bust of Theodosius, spear over right shoulder, shield adorned with horseman motif
Reverse: Constantinopolis enthroned to left, holding globus cruciger and sceptre, resting left foot on prow, star in left field, COMOB in exergue
